SUDBURY, September 17, 2012 –Vale is pleased to announce that as a result of the ‘Vale Concert Series’, $17,500 was raised in support of the Sudbury Food Bank.
The series of five concerts began in May and was held throughout the summer at The Grace Hartman Amphitheatre. Admission to the community was free with monetary donations to the Sudbury Food Bank welcomed.
“This was the first event of its kind for Vale and we were thrilled with the outcome,” said Angie Robson, Manager of Corporate Affairs for Vale’s Ontario Operations. “We thank everyone who came out to hear some great Canadian music while at the same time giving so generously,” added Robson.
Past concerts featured Dave Gunning, Hemingway Corner, the Marigolds, Wendell Ferguson and Katherine Wheatley. The final concert, featuring Murray McLauchlan and Cindy Church, drew a crowd of more than 1,200 local residents. It is estimated that in total, approximately 3,500 people attended the five concerts.
